ok day 3 and its in even more little bits

carbs are off (restrictors out) and im gona rebuild them doing the HRC drill slides mod and give them a clean up

Image
Image

new rearsets are almost fitted although had a couple of problems with the gear lever side, the con-rod is too long so need a new one made up, could possible do with a spacer made up so to space the hangers from the swinger a bit and when i mounted the bit on the gear selector there was clearance prblems with the thing infront of it (water pipe goes into it) so couldnt have it in race pattern setup, all will be sorted tho.

got the HRC style res and braided line on the master cylinder and on the HRC sets and wa about to drill the swinger and I had a look at the original line and its different from the braided one I got off a forum member on here (not saying who), so after a panic i called Rick O who saved the day with a banjo bolt and said it should fit aslong as you take the in-line adapter out of the caliper, so as soon as that arrives il be drilling the swinger and fitting all that lot

yeh the pannels are back from the painters and i thik they rock, just need a set of 11 to complete the look but im happy with it for the moment

the bikes finished and it took alot longer than anticipated, lots of problems help me up, the worst was trying to fit the carbs which took me th ebest part of 2 days to do in the end, think my rubbers are past it but im pleased i did it all int he end

here she is:

Image
Image
ImageImage


iv fitted everything i had piliing up in my room which included, NSR 250 quick action throttle with single nsr cable, HRC rearsets, braided line through swinger (out the bottom to make it ultra sly) with switch, foam filled swinger, new fluid in brake systems, last of the samco hoses which was hard to get to without the carbs off, extra shim in the carb slides, restrictors out, rebuilt and cleaned carbs referbed the hub and generally give the bike a good post winter clean up
